Question
Who sits second the left of A? I. Eight
friends are sitting around a circular table four facing towards the center and four facing away from the center such that no two people facing in the same direction are sitting adjacent to each other. A sits second to the left of G who sits fourth to the right of B. F and H are the immediate neighbours of A and face outside. II. Eight friends are sitting around a circular table such that friends sitting alternately are facing in the same direction (away from the center or towards the center). A, B, G and E face towards the center and C, D, F, H face away from the center.Β Each of the questions given below has one question and two statements marked I and II.Β Β You have to decide whether the data provided in the statements are sufficient to answer the question. Read both the statements and give answer.Solution
From 1, we know that, people sitting adjacent to each other face in opposite directions. Thus, if neighbours of A face outside, A faces inside. Also, A sits second to the left of G thus G also faces inside and by placing B such that G sits fourth to the right of B, we get the following arrangement.
From II, we know that A, B, G and E face towards the center and C, D, F, H face away from the center, but do not know their placements and position.
